Created in 1958 for the interior of the Chamber of Commerce of Milan, this chair is designed to combine comfort and stackability. The same concept was revived for contemporary settings, but with a fundamental difference: unlike the iron frame of the original project, it is now in warm ash wood.

Designed in 1970 by Giancarlo Piiretti, plona is a folding and stackable armchair. A truly unique design that combines aesthetics, functionality and comfort.
